What radio station sends a signal with a wavelength of 3.25 meters?

Frequency = speed/wavelength = 3 x 108 / 3.25 = 92.3 MHz. In the US, that frequency is in the commercial FM broadcast band (88 - 108 MHz). There are many FM stations, in many different cities, on that frequency.


A radio station's channel such as 100.7 FM or 92.3 FM is actually its frequency in megahertz where Calculate the broadcast wavelength of the radio station 104.9 FM?

Wavelength = Speed of light/frequency Wavelength= 300'000'000/104'900'000 (FM 104.9 is frequency modulation 104.9 MHz) Wavelength=2.86 meters

What are the sizes of radio waves?

One convenient working definition of 'radio' is: Electromagnetic radiationwith frequency up to 300 GHz / wavelength down to 1 millimeter.'Radio' is our name for the lowest frequency / longest wavelength, sothere's no lower limit on frequency, or upper limit on wavelength.-- AM commercial radio broadcast band . . .550 KHz to 1.7 MHz176.5 to 545.5 meters-- FM commercial radio broadcast band . . .88 to 108 MHz2.78 to 3.41 meters-- Radio-wave energy used to heat leftover meat loafin a microwave oven:2.45 GHz12.2 centimeters

Am radio frequency from 540-1700kHz what is the shortest wavelenght?

Shortest wavelength corresponds to highest frequency.Within the AM broadcast band, that's 1700 KHz.Wavelength = speed/frequency = 176.35 meters(rounded)
